The protests, which took place in the week leading up to Christmas Day 2021, were billed as"a community art build" by the protesters and were calling for sanctuary camping for the city's homeless population following a series of police sweeps of encampments that winter. The felony littering charges followed December 2021 protests at Aston Park, and various North Carolina attorneys have called the charges "rare" and "unusual.. Although 16 people were indicted by a Buncombe County grand jury in June, court records indicate three defendants have since taken plea deals, and on Jan. 23, only five of the 13 remaining defendants are currently set to go to trial. Buncombe County Courthouse, 60 Court Plaza Asheville, NC 28801 Phone: (828) 259-3400 The Superior Court handles criminal cases of felonies, misdemeanors, and infractions appeals from the lower court, and civil cases with claims above $25,000. View information about North Carolina Family Courts, which are specialized programs in District Court that handle related family matters such as divorce, child custody and visitation, juvenile delinquency, dependency, abuse and neglect, termination of parental rights, and domestic violence.
